THE BOTANIC GARDEN




The Botanic Garden of Bogotá (José Celestino Mutis) was founded in 1955, due to the botanic expedition, one of the most important expeditions of the XVIII century, it had a period of 33 years, where 20,000 plants and 7,000 animals where cataloged.
The Botanic Garden has been a foundation, corporation and now an entity from the mayor of Bogotá.
